logo

Output f82039816dc6f3ca682902ea6575d71b3d660c1de16a966a988c17be9a70ff54:0

value
37093542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f454ba71fa8609d4c4f35ec9a5d326bb3a8865f OP_EQUALVERIFY OP_CHECKSIG
address
15JwmkgPTcrrucrvqn9fmME3DqLvLGKcen
transaction
f82039816dc6f3ca682902ea6575d71b3d660c1de16a966a988c17be9a70ff54